Output e15ba792c77eca57ef8886dd24cd9e86ffa08f366997c509fd79533029ec7c8d:17

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 886c26c87da6e8a1b4b98a3cc74f9e75e8493c9ccbb61e4d64f45e1d967cc528
address
bc1p3pkzdjra5m52rd9e3g7vwnu7wh5yj0yuewmpunty730pm9nuc55qzzpp6w
transaction
e15ba792c77eca57ef8886dd24cd9e86ffa08f366997c509fd79533029ec7c8d
spent
true